Camerontoll presents a one-day corporate volunteering opportunity with British Heart Foundation in Bristol. This initiative allows you to sort donated stock, prepare donations for sale, and create seasonal displays. It's designed for corporate volunteers, providing a chance to connect with colleagues, learn new skills, and make a positive impact.

Volunteers can commit a few hours or a full day, with a maximum group size of 2. Bring unwanted clothes to donate. This opportunity helps fund vital research for heart disease.
